WASHINGTON 鈥 American University students asked the university to do more to address the problem of racism on campus during a protest Monday.

A few hundred people showed up to a protest on campus Monday afternoon in the wake of in the dorms earlier this month.

On Sept. 8, a black woman said someone threw a banana at her while she was in her dorm room and another black woman said she found a rotten banana outside her door, along with obscene drawings on the whiteboard attached to her door.

American University said the students responsible for the incidents have been disciplined.

鈥淎merican University鈥檚 negligence is what has allowed this to happen. There鈥檚 a reason students feel comfortable to assault black students on campus,鈥 said Black Student Alliance President Ma鈥檃t Sargeant at the protest.

Protesters聽said the university has a history of racism and not dealing with it.

鈥淣othing is ever done; no AU alerts, no consequences. Just town halls where we speak to deaf ears,鈥 Sargeant said.

The protest came the same day the university鈥檚 president called for and create a more inclusive climate. The incidents have left the black students 鈥渟haken, upset, and even feeling unsafe,鈥 American University President Neil Kerwin said Monday.
